CVE-2023-7288
Last modified
CVE-2023-7288 is a medium-severity vulnerability rated 4.3/10 on the CVSS scale. The Paytium: Mollie payment forms & donations pl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to unauthorized data modification due to a missing capability check on the update_profile_preference function in versions up to, and including, 4.3.7.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ers with subscriber-level access to change plugin settings.. EPSS estimates a 0.27%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
